Understanding Vacuum Packing Machines and Their Functionality
Vacuum packing machines are essential for preserving food and enhancing its shelf life. These devices operate by removing air from bags around food items before sealing them tight. This process slows down spoilage, making vacuum sealing a popular choice in both households and commercial settings. According to a report by Allied Market Research, the global vacuum packaging market is projected to reach $32.75 billion by 2027, growing at a CAGR of 5.4%. This reflects a rising trend in food preservation solutions.
Understanding the functionality of these machines can help you make informed choices. High-quality vacuum packing machines use heat sealing to ensure airtight seals. The best models may feature adjustable suction levels to accommodate different food types. However, not all machines perform equally. Some might struggle with moisture-rich foods. It’s crucial to choose a machine that fits your specific packaging needs.

Key Features to Consider When Choosing a Vacuum Packing Machine
When choosing a vacuum packing machine, consider the key features that will best suit your needs. One crucial aspect is the vacuum strength. A strong vacuum will remove air efficiently, prolonging food freshness. Check the machine's ability to handle various food types, from dry foods to liquids. Some machines struggle with liquid items, leading to messy results.
Another important feature is the sealing capabilities. Machines with adjustable sealing settings allow you to work with different bag materials. A machine that can handle both soft and hard bags gives you flexibility. Also, consider its ease of use. A user-friendly interface can make the packing process smoother, especially if you are a beginner.
Don’t overlook the machine’s size and storage capacity. Larger machines take up more space but can handle bulk items. Think about your kitchen layout. A compact model may be better if you have limited space. Additionally, reflect on the durability and maintenance needs of the machine. Investing in a quality vacuum packing machine can save you time and effort in the long run.
Types of Vacuum Packing Machines for Different Packaging Needs
When it comes to vacuum packing machines, understanding the different types available is crucial for effective packaging. Various models cater to unique packaging needs, influencing efficiency and storage. For instance, chamber vacuum sealers are known for their ability to handle bulk items. They work by creating a vacuum within a chamber, providing excellent sealing for food preservation. According to industry reports, these machines can increase shelf life by 3 to 5 times compared to traditional methods.
On the other hand, external vacuum sealers are more suitable for smaller batches. They are easy to use and often more affordable. Ideal for home kitchens, these machines operate by removing air from a bag before sealing it. Research indicates that more than 60% of home cooks prefer external models for convenience. However, they may not be as efficient for liquid-rich foods, which can lead to imperfect seals and wasted resources.
Impulse heat sealers serve another specific need, particularly in retail packaging. They are designed for quick sealing of pre-made bags. While they excel in speed, users may encounter issues like inconsistent sealing, particularly if bag sizes vary. This highlights the importance of choosing the right machine for your specific application, ensuring efficiency and effectiveness in your packaging process.
Benefits of Using Vacuum Packing Machines for Food Preservation
Vacuum packing machines have revolutionized food preservation. They remove air from packaging, significantly extending shelf life. According to the USDA, vacuum-packaged food can last 2-3 times longer than food stored in standard packaging. This is critical for both home and commercial kitchens aiming to reduce waste.
One of the primary benefits of vacuum packing is the prevention of freezer burn. Traditional storage methods often result in ice crystals forming on food. In contrast, vacuum sealing minimizes air exposure, preserving flavor and texture. Another advantage is the reduction of bacteria growth. A study by the Journal of Food Science found that vacuum-sealed foods can inhibit microbial growth effectively. The increased safety and quality are vital for anyone serious about food preservation.
However, it’s essential to note potential drawbacks. Not all foods freeze well after vacuum sealing. For instance, delicate items like lettuce may get squished. Additionally, if improperly sealed, food can spoil rapidly. It’s crucial to master the techniques of sealing for optimal results. Overall, understanding these factors can enhance the use of vacuum packing machines in your kitchen.
Tips for Maintaining and Maximizing the Efficiency of Vacuum Machines
To maintain and maximize the efficiency of your vacuum packing machine, regular upkeep is essential. A clean machine performs better. Start by routinely wiping down the sealing area. Any debris can compromise the seal integrity. Remember to check the vacuum chamber for any residue. Small remnants can lead to larger issues if ignored.
Tips for maintaining your vacuum machine include inspecting the gaskets. Ensure they are in good condition and free from cracks. Replacing worn gaskets can significantly improve sealing effectiveness. Additionally, avoid overfilling the bags. Instead of packing items to the brim, leave some space for optimal sealing.
Don’t overlook the importance of proper storage. Keep your machine in a dry environment. Moisture can lead to corrosion and damage. Lastly, consult the user manual for specific maintenance tips. Each machine has unique needs and requirements. Regular attention can prolong its lifespan and efficiency.
